Jet-Lube AP-5 High-Temp Grease: How an MoS2 Compound Protects Bearings from 0°F to 550°F

What Is JetLube AP-5 and Why Does It Not Melt at High Temperatures?

JetLube AP-5 is a black, smooth, non-melting, water-resistant grease formulated from an organo clay (bentone clay) thickener rather than a conventional soap base. Because bentone clay does not exhibit a dropping point under ASTM D-566 testing — the value is listed as None — AP-5 retains its structural integrity at temperatures conventional soap-thickened greases cannot tolerate. This is the defining characteristic that separates AP-5 from standard multi-purpose greases in high-temperature applications.

The operating range runs from 0°F (-18°C) to 550°F (288°C), and the grease does not thicken excessively even at the low end of that range. Its flash point exceeds 560°F (293°C) per ASTM D-92, and the calculated autoignition point exceeds 680°F (360°C), providing substantial safety margin in furnace-adjacent environments such as oven conveyors and kiln bearings.

How Does MoS2 Improve Film Strength and Reduce Wear in AP-5?

JetLube AP-5 contains molybdenum disulfide (MoS2) as a solid-film lubricant additive, which yields high film strength with a low coefficient of friction. MoS2 platelet structures bridge metal surfaces under heavy load, reducing fretting corrosion in oscillating or slow-moving contacts — a common failure mode in kiln bearings, press guides, and crane ladle pivots.

The Shell 4-Ball test results (ASTM D-2596) quantify extreme-pressure performance: a weld point of 250 kgf and a load wear index of 40, with a wear scar diameter of 0.7 mm (ASTM D-2266). These figures confirm AP-5’s suitability for heavy-duty industrial loads where boundary lubrication conditions exist. The additive package also includes oxidation inhibitors, corrosion inhibitors, and metal deactivators, with oxidation resistance measured at less than 5.0 PSI drop over 100 hours (ASTM D-942).

What Equipment and Applications Is JetLube AP-5 Designed For?

JetLube AP-5 is approved for a broad set of industrial and oilfield applications. The source identifies the following primary use cases:

  • Anti-friction bearings — ball and roller bearings, sleeve bearings, and journals
  • Heavy-industry rotating equipment — kiln bearings, crushers, crane ladles
  • Mechanical guides — press and hammer guides, lift-bridge pin bearings
  • High-temperature rotating equipment — blowers, fans, and oven conveyors
  • General lubrication — shackles, slides, conveyor chains, U-joints, sealed assemblies, chassis
  • Oilfield connection lubrication (certain approved applications)

The NLGI Grade 2 rating and penetration of 265–295 at 77°F (ASTM D-217) place AP-5 in the standard general-purpose consistency range, making it compatible with most grease fittings and centralized lubrication systems without modification.

How Does AP-5’s Copper Strip Corrosion Rating Protect Metal Surfaces?

JetLube AP-5 earns a Copper Strip Corrosion rating of 1A (ASTM D-4048), the most favorable classification in that test. A 1A rating confirms the grease is non-corrosive to copper alloys — relevant for bronze bushings, brass fittings, and copper-wound motor housings commonly found in the industrial equipment AP-5 targets.

The combined presence of corrosion inhibitors, metal deactivators, and the MoS2 solid-film additive provides a multilayer defense: the inhibitors address electrochemical corrosion, the deactivators neutralize reactive metal ions, and MoS2 maintains a physical barrier even when the oil film thins under shock loading.

What Are AP-5’s Physical and Storage Characteristics?

AP-5 has a specific gravity of 0.92 and a density of 7.70 lb/gal. Base oil viscosity ranges from 414–506 cSt at 40°C (ASTM D-445), indicating a high-viscosity base oil appropriate for slow-speed, high-load bearing contacts. The fluid type is listed as lube oil, and the additive system combines organic additives with MoS2.

The grease is noted for superior storage life, mechanical stability under working conditions, and high adhesion to metal surfaces — characteristics that reduce re-lubrication frequency and product waste in field service. Water resistance further protects against washout in wet process environments such as paper mills, food processing conveyors, or outdoor crane operations.
